Ruby on rails Rails应用程序:预编译资产失败
我正在尝试将rails应用程序推送到Heroku,但出现以下错误: “找不到文件‘turbolinks’-但是‘turbolinks’在我的文件(附件)中。”Ruby on rails Rails应用程序:预编译资产失败,ruby-on-rails,ruby,heroku,turbolinks,Ruby On Rails,Ruby,Heroku,Turbolinks,我正在尝试将rails应用程序推送到Heroku,但出现以下错误: “找不到文件‘turbolinks’-但是‘turbolinks’在我的文件(附件)中。” Rails 4不再使用:assets组。请参见此处的SO和讨论:。这是否回答了为什么资产不会预编译的问题?我用Rails 4创建了一个应用程序,没有像此人那样列出我的资产,但我仍然得到一个错误。 source 'https://rubygems.org' gem 'rails', '4.0.0' gem 'jquery-rails'
Rails 4不再使用
:assets
组。请参见此处的SO和讨论:。这是否回答了为什么资产不会预编译的问题?我用Rails 4创建了一个应用程序,没有像此人那样列出我的资产,但我仍然得到一个错误。
source 'https://rubygems.org'
gem 'rails', '4.0.0'
gem 'jquery-rails'
group :production do
gem 'pg'
end
group :development, :test do
gem 'sqlite3'
end
group :assets do
gem 'sass-rails', '~> 4.0.0'
gem 'uglifier', '>= 1.3.0'
gem 'coffee-rails', '~> 4.0.0'
gem 'turbolinks'
gem 'jbuilder', '~> 1.2'
end
group :doc do
gem 'sdoc', require: false
end